The Auld Scots Yule: Christmas Traditions of Scotland - Expanded and Updated

New edition - updated and expanded from the original with over 50% extra material To speak of Scottish Christmas traditions may seem like a contradiction in terms. Hogmanay is famously the bigger occasion; Yule was suppressed by the Kirk for centuries, until it almost disappeared. The country's modern celebrations are nearly all imported. But once upon a time, Scotland did have Christmas customs of its own. We still have records of its games and mummeries, carols and rhymes, dishes and drinks, from Galloway to Shetland. So boil up some fat brose and bake a care-cake, brew some treacle-and-ginger ale, practise your street football and jollie-at-the-goose, and get ready to celebrate an auld Scots Yule
